Please use a system of equations to solve this problem. I already know how to solve this, but I want to know how to solve it usi
DiKsa [7]

Answer:

\boxed{\sf \ \ \ 15 \ \ novelists \ \ and \ \ 9 \ \ poets \ \ \ }

Step-by-step explanation:

hello,

let's note a the number of novelists and

b the number of poets.

we know that a = 5/3 b as "enrolls novelits and poets in a ratio of 5:3"

it comes 3a=5b which is the first equation

and we know that a + b = 24 "there are 24 people"

we we have two equations

(1) 3a - 5b = 0

(2) a + b = 24

let's multiply (2) by 3 it comes 3a + 3b = 24*3 = 72

let's do 3*(2) - (1) it comes

3a + 3b -3a + 5b = 72 - 0 = 72

so 8b = 72

so b = 9

and then we replace b in (2) it comes

a = 24-9 = 15
